Block 664,244
Block Hash
dfd21283ec0ed0ff1d82bb8f92abfd052912783ed2dfbd92d7abe786eab3a50c
Previous Block Hash
fee9482842da24e9ab35319fd43af26bc3814b81e437fc6a231cf4ce1e71bf21
Mined
Transactions
1
Difficulty
28.54 M
Size
172 bytes
Transactions (1)
1 input, 1 output
10,000.00
PEPE